Common use of Rule 4 Clause in Contracts

Rule 4. If Tenant shall occupy the leased premises prior to the beginning of the term, such occupancy shall be subject to the terms of this lease. Rent shall be paid for the same period from the date of such occupancy to the beginning of said term. If Tenant occupies the premises beyond the ending date of the lease agreement, a $200 per day holdover fee will be levied against Tenant for each day or part of day beyond the ending date.
